This one is part of a panorama Todd Webb put together.

--Sixth Avenue Between 43rd and 44th Streets, New York, 1948
Todd Webb composed Sixth Avenue Between 43rd and 44th Streets, New
York, 1948 from eight separate images. It depicts the west side of
Sixth Avenue between West 43rd and 44th Streets, taken on the
afternoon of March 24, 1948. Realizing he had to work fast to retain
the same light, Webb plotted the shoot beforehand, lining up the edges
of each photo with chalk marks on the sidewalk. The image was
exhibited at the 1958 Brussels Worlds Fair, and he became
internationally recognized as the "historian with a camera."
